Efficient and Effective Engines Found Under the Hood of the Ford Escape and Chevy Equinox
When looking for an efficient vehicle, one of the first areas you will want to take a look at is the engine offered. Here, both the Escape and Equinox will delight.
Under the hood of the Equinox, you will find a 1.5L 4-cylinder engine that pumps out 170 horsepower. Similarly, the Escape comes configured with a 1.5L EcoBoost® engine that will deliver up to 181 horsepower. Perhaps more important than their power figures are the fuel economy ratings offered. Measuring the Interior Dimensions for the Escape and Equinox
If you’re interested in an SUV, you are also likely interested in the space you’ll have available to you for both passengers and cargo. For the Equinox, you’ll have a passenger capacity of five with a passenger volume of 103.5 cubic feet. While the Escape also offers a seating capacity of five, you also have a bit more passenger space, with 104 cubic feet.
It is also the Ford Escape that offers you more storage room. Behind its second row of seats, you will find 33.5 cubic feet of cargo volume to work with. Under the same conditions, the Equinox only offers 29.9 cubic feet of cargo volume. So, you’ll have a bit more room for those extra necessities in the Ford.
Tons of Technology Available With the Ford Escape and Chevy Equinox
The Escape and Equinox are also highly capable family vehicles. As such, they come with several driver-assistive technology features which are designed to keep you as safe as possible on the roadways. Some of these features include:
- Pre-Collision Assist
- Automatic Emergency Braking
- Lane-Keeping System
While the vehicles share some of these features, the Ford does come standard with a BLIS® (Blind Spot Information System) with Cross-Traffic Alert. This system will monitor the areas around your vehicle where you cannot see, alerting you when obstructions present themselves. If you want a comparable system in the Chevy, you’ll have to upgrade to get it.
